CROWDS braved the Bank Holiday weather for the Hereford Rotary River Festival.

The city's rowing club hosted the day which featured Dragon Boat Racing, tug-of-war contests and a floating army of plastic ducks.

Each one of the yellow toys were sponsored in the form of raffle tickets before they were dropped from the Hunderton footbridge into the waters of the Wye below.

The ducks then floated down towards Greyfriars Bridge in a much more leisurely fashion than the Dragon Boats.

Jules Knowles was the owner of the quickest duck and collected £1,000 for picking the plastic fantastic winner.

Meanwhile Arnold Engineering scooped the business duck race prize.

Luke Conod, from the Rotary Club, said more than £5,000 was raised for local and international causes on a day that went "really well despite the overnight rain".
